    Position Summary

    The Senior Manager / Principal Attorney – Global Trade Compliance will support the Global Trade Compliance team in conducting reviews of business operations to assess compliance with U.S. export and import regulations.

    This position will also support internal investigations of potential compliance matters and the preparation of disclosures related to instances of non-compliance. The role requires an experienced trade compliance professional with advanced knowledge of U.S. export controls, strong investigative and writing capabilities, and the ability to operate independently within a complex, highly matrixed organization.

    The ideal candidate will be an experienced Empowered Official with expertise in the International Traffic in Arms Regulations (ITAR) and Export Administration Regulations (EAR) and experience managing or supporting voluntary disclosures.

    Education & Experience

    Candidates must meet one of the following combinations of education and relevant experience:

    • Bachelor's degree with at least 8 years of export control experience, including investigations.
    • Master's degree with at least 6 years of export control experience, including investigations.
    • Juris Doctor (JD) with at least 4 years of experience in export compliance investigations.
